Kaleidoscope

A captivating child's toy, obscuring what's behind.

Stained glass shards just reassemble with a shift of view,
Wheeling like a mandala rolling through the pews.

Mythic hero, evil foil, strict but loving Dad;
Temper prone but all supportive Mother of the land.

Splintered echoes seen reflected over history;
We all share a lot as people, but what does it mean?

Is there some truth that underlies, or is it all pretense?
Are we simply overwhelmed without that fractured lens?
